Harvey Weinstein has hired Jacob Kaplan, Marc Agnifilo, and Teny Geragos from Agnifilo Intrater to represent him in his third New York trial.
The new legal team replaces Arthur Aidala, who will focus on Weinstein's appeals and civil matters.
Kaplan and Agnifilo previously represented Luigi Mangione, securing favorable outcomes in his case.
Agnifilo and Geragos also represented Sean "Diddy" Combs in his sex trafficking and racketeering trial.
The retrial stems from a 2020 conviction that was overturned, and involves charges of rape and a criminal sex act.
